Henkel expects profit growth for 2010
Henkel expects remarkable improvement in its results this year. The company is confident, that its organic revenue growth exceeds the results of the relevant markets.
Last year, Henkel's sales turnover was 13 573 million euros, which is a 3.9 percent decrease, compared to the previous year. In the first quarter, significant decline occured, due to the effect of the economic downturn, while the further quarters brought steady increase.
The operating result (EBIT) increased by 38.6 percent to 1 080 million euros, from 779 million euros.
